Happy Sunday Husky fans. It’s a little quiet on the recruiting front right now, but today I wanted to talk about the 2028 class and who could potentially be the first commit in the class (with the majority of the 2027 class already committed).
My first instinct is to look locally and here are some players I could see that might commit at some point over the next several months:
3 star safety Markel Newell from Puyallup HS, has been a target for the Huskies for a long time and is a player the Huskies have been recruiting for a long time. Many believe he is very similar to former Husky great Budda Baker and Newell has a similar frame (5’9” and around 190 pounds). If Newell could be anywhere near Baker he would be a massive addition for any college program, and so far Arizona, ASU, Boise State and WSU have extended offers for Newell. Last season Newell had 50 total tackles, 6TFL’s, and 1 Int.
Currently unranked linebacker Ioelu Feo from Bethel HS, WA is another player I am monitoring. The Huskies have had massive success from Bethel with 2 current Huskies on the roster (Zaydrius Rainey-Sale, and Ramzak Fruean). Listed at 6’2” and round 210 pounds Feo has great size for the position and reminds me a lot of Rainey-Sale. Feo camped with the Huskies this summer and got an offer during the camp after showing off his abilities in front of the coaches. The linebacker room has gotten bigger and looked for larger frames over the last couple of years and Feo fits the mold that they are looking for.
4 star defensive lineman Aedyn Havili from Eastside Catholic is the 2nd rated player in-state and a massive target for the Huskies (both literally and figuratively for the Huskies). Listed at 6’2” and around 320 pounds Havili is massive and has already been offered by LSU, Michigan, Ohio State, Oregon, Penn State, and UCLA. The Huskies are the local school and it sounds like Havili is very interested in playing in front of his family in college. Last season he had 33 total tackles, 7.5 sacks and 7TFL’s.

There are plenty of other in-state prospects who could pull the trigger early, and it will be interesting to see who ends up in the P&G in-state in the 2028 class (it’s another good class and the Huskies have done a good job in positioning themselves early).
